BAHX Cold Box Heat Exchanger for LNG Liquefaction from Canada
A brazed aluminum plate-fin heat exchanger integrated into LNG cold boxes for natural gas liquefaction, facilitating multi-stream heat transfer at sub-zero temperatures. Classified under HTS 8419.50.10.00 for its role in industrial cooling and condensing processes.

Import Tips
• Obtain cryogenic testing certifications (e.g
• impact tests at -196°C) to prove suitability for LNG applications
• Declare fin density, passage configurations, and brazing process details to confirm classification
• Beware of valuation issues; exclude installation costs from customs value for modular cold box units
